THE AM¥AL UNDER THE AUSPICES OP THE WAIRARAPA AND EAST COAST PASTORAL AND AGRICULTURAL SOCIETY WILL BE' HELD ON THESHOW.GROUNDS, CARTERTON, ON WEDNESDAY, 25th FEBRUARY, .188 5. E" NTRIES,-.accompanied by the entrance fees, close at the Secretary's Office, Carterton on SATURDAY, 21st •February, 1885, and' in order'that sufficient accommodation may be provided for tho sheep, and correct catalogues may be prepared, vendors are requested to atato the number, sex, class, and age of sheep ; ■•whether'they-are to be soldby auction or .privately; and if by auction,, to state by whom • also to 'atato whether the sheep are to be sold singly, or in- lots of 5,10, 20, etc., etc. All sheep to be on.the ground before 10 a,m., and to be removed only by consent of the Stewards, Vendors will please note that in lieu of allotting pens by priority of entry it has been decided to draw lots for'the pens in such manner that each Auctioneer will as near as possible have a consecutive sale of 60 sheep at a time. •Entries to bo made on printed forms, which can bo obtained from the Secretary, or by letter or telegram, care being taken that full particulars are given. Sale to commenee at 11 a.m. sharp. '. ENTRANCE FEES. First Five sheep ... Is per head, Over that number ... Gd per head. Single sheep ... ... 2s per. head. •Admission to the Grounds—FßEE, H.H. WOLTERS, Secretary. Carterton, 6th Jan., 1885. ■
